import os # to list files, directories
from os.path import isfile, join # to list files
from os import system
from fnmatch import fnmatch # to match .fits .txt .. extenctions
from astropy.io import fits
import numpy as np
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
import scipy.stats as stats
from numpy import sqrt, pi, exp, linspace
from scipy import optimize
from scipy.interpolate import interp1d
from scipy.optimize import curve_fit
from astropy.modeling import models, fitting
from astropy.table import Table, Column
def readdata(name):
"""
this function reads the fits file
"""
global source, freq, bw, el, time, rtsys, dec, ra, rp, lp
header_table0 = fits.getheader(name,0)
source = header_table0['source']
freq = header_table0['freq']
bw = header_table0['bw']
az = header_table0['az']
el = header_table0['el']
time = header_table0['time']
rtsys = header_table0['rtsys']
data_table, header_table = fits.getdata(name, 1, header=True)
dec = data_table.field('DDEC')
ra = data_table.field('DRA')
rp = data_table.field('RP')
lp = data_table.field('LP')
def gauss_fit(a,b):
"""
this function fits the gauss
"""
global r
g_init = models.Gaussian1D(amplitude=1., mean=0, stddev=1.)
fit_g = fitting.LevMarLSQFitter()
r = fit_g(g_init, a, b)
def parameters(r,y,el,N):
"""
calculate parameters of the gauss fit, write results to the file
"""
global maximum, sigma, mean, fwhm
maximum = r.amplitude.value # Amplitude Y-coordinate
fwhm = 2.3548*r.stddev.value # HPBW
mean = r.mean.value #offset value X-coordinate
off_corr = np.exp(-4.0 * np.log(2.0) * (mean/fwhm)**2.0)
T = maximum / off_corr
savename = name.split('.')[0]
if N==2:
# calculate uncertainty of gauss fit
sigma = np.sqrt(sum((r(x) - sbtr)**2)/len(r(x)))
data_rows = [(name, source, el, time, rtsys, maximum, T, sigma, fwhm, mean)]
t = Table(rows=data_rows, names=('File', 'Name', 'Elevat', 'Time(MJD)', 'Tsys(K)', 'Max(K)', 'T_oc', 'sigma', 'FWHM', 'Offset'),
dtype=('S7', 'S8',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4', 'f4'))
t['Max(K)'].format = '.3f'
t['T_oc'].format = '.3f'
t['Elevat'].format = '.3f'
t['Time(MJD)'].format = '.3f'
t['Tsys(K)'].format = '.3f'
t['FWHM'].format = '.2f'
t['sigma'].format = '.3f'
t['Offset'].format = '.2f'
t.write(str(savename)+'_'+pol+'.txt', format='ascii', overwrite=True)
def baseline_calc():
''' calculating baseline
xx1, xx2 - left and right borders of the gauss fit
bb1, bb2 - left and right borders for the baseline calc
b1, b2 - INDEX of the value closets to border (bb1,bb2)
xx,yy - sets of two points to use in interpolation
'''
global bb1, bb2, f, sbtr
xx1 = mean - fwhm
if xx1 > 0:
bb1 = int(fwhm/2 + xx1)
else:
bb1 = int(xx1 - fwhm/2)
xx2 = mean + fwhm
if xx2 > 0:
bb2 = int(fwhm/2 + xx2)
else:
bb2 = int(xx2 - fwhm/2)
''' to know INDEX of the value closets to baseline border in X-array'''
b1 = min(range(len(x)), key=lambda i: abs(x[i]-bb1))
b2 = min(range(len(x)), key=lambda i: abs(x[i]-bb2))
''' linear interpolation between 2 points (baseline)'''
yy1 = y[b1]
yy2 = y[b2]
xx = (bb1,bb2)
yy = (yy1,yy2)
f = interp1d(xx, yy, "linear", bounds_error=False)
sbtr = y - f(x)
inds = np.where(np.isnan(sbtr))
sbtr[inds] = 0
def rms_calc():
''' calculating rms at different parts of scan
'''
global b1, b2, b3, b4, rms_first, rms_second
b1 = int(0.6 * len(x))
b2 = int(0.8 * len(x))
b3 = -int(0.6 * len(x))
b4 = -int(0.8 * len(x))
first = list(range(b1,b2,1))
second = list(range(b4,b3,1))
rms_first = np.std(rp[first])
rms_second = np.std(rp[second])
def plot_source(x,y):
"""
this function plots the figures
"""
plt.title('File=%s, Source=%s, Freq(GHz)=%.2f BW=%.1f \n Ampl(K)=%.2f Sigma=%.2f, Offset(")=%.2f'
% (name, source, freq, bw, maximum, sigma, mean), fontsize=9)
plt.plot(x, y, 'r-', label='Data')
plt.plot(x, f(x), 'y-', lw=1, label='baseline')
plt.axvline(x=bb1, color='y', lw=.75, label='0+1.5*HPBW')
plt.axvline(x=bb2, color='y', lw=.75)
plt.plot(x, r(x), '.', label='Gaussian')
plt.ylabel(r'$T_{ant}, K$')
plt.xlabel(scan+' , arcsec')
plt.legend(prop={'size':10}, labelspacing=0.1)
savename = name.split('.')[0]
plt.savefig(str(savename)+'_'+pol+'.png', bbox_inches='tight')
plt.clf()
def catfiles():
"""
compound resulting files using bash 'cat' procedure
"""
system("cat *_RP.txt> RP_result.txt")
system("cat *_LP.txt> LP_result.txt")
def rmrows():
"""
remove extra headings after compounding files
"""
f=open('RP_result.txt').readlines()
if len(f) > 3:
rows = (len(f) + 2) / 2
row_rem = np.arange(2,rows)
for i in row_rem:
f.pop(i)
with open('RP_result.txt','w') as F:
F.writelines(f)
g=open('LP_result.txt').readlines()
if len(g) > 3:
rows = (len(g) + 2) / 2
row_rem = np.arange(2,rows)
for i in row_rem:
g.pop(i)
with open('LP_result.txt','w') as F:
F.writelines(g)
def rmfiles():
"""
remove temporary files
"""
system("rm *_RP.txt")
system("rm *_LP.txt")
def list_files():
"""
List files in a directory
"""
global names
pattern = "*.fits"
files = [f for f in os.listdir('.') if os.path.isfile(f)] #current path
names = []
for name in files:
if fnmatch(name, pattern):
names.append(name) # write fits file to the list
def choose_scan():
"""
(RA/DEC)
"""
global scan, x
if name[0] == "R":
scan = "RA"
x = ra
else:
scan = "Dec"
x = dec
list_files()
for name in names:
''' # RP '''
pol = 'RP'
readdata(name)
y = rp
choose_scan()
gauss_fit(x,y)
N=1
parameters(r,y,el,N)
baseline_calc()
gauss_fit(x,sbtr)
N=2
parameters(r,y,el,N)
rms_calc()
plot_source(x,y)
''' # LP '''
pol = 'LP'
y = lp
choose_scan()
gauss_fit(x,y)
N=1
parameters(r,y,el,N)
baseline_calc()
gauss_fit(x,sbtr)
N=2
parameters(r,y,el,N)
rms_calc()
plot_source(x,y)
catfiles()
rmrows()
rmfiles()
